Skip to content

Commit 8a04241

Browse files
committed
Bumped version to 0.11.5
1 parent 3e874a9 commit 8a04241

File tree

4 files changed

+12
-9
lines changed

4 files changed

+12
-9
lines changed

Cargo.lock

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

Cargo.toml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
[package]
22
name = "psqlpy"
3-
version = "0.11.4"
3+
version = "0.11.5"
44
edition = "2021"
55

66
# See more keys and their definitions at https://doc.rust-lang.org/cargo/reference/manifest.html

python/psqlpy/_internal/__init__.pyi

Lines changed: 0 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-308,15 +308,8 @@ class Cursor:
308308
"""
309309

310310
array_size: int
311-
cursor_name: str
312311
querystring: str
313312
parameters: ParamsT = None
314-
prepared: bool | None
315-
conn_dbname: str | None
316-
user: str | None
317-
host_addrs: list[str]
318-
hosts: list[str]
319-
ports: list[int]
320313

321314
def __aiter__(self: Self) -> Self: ...
322315
async def __anext__(self: Self) -> QueryResult: ...

src/driver/cursor.rs

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-73,6 +73,16 @@ impl Drop for Cursor {
7373

7474
#[pymethods]
7575
impl Cursor {
76+
#[getter]
77+
fn get_querystring(&self) -> Option<String> {
78+
self.querystring.clone()
79+
}
80+
81+
#[getter]
82+
fn get_parameters(&self) -> Option<Py<PyAny>> {
83+
self.parameters.clone()
84+
}
85+
7686
#[getter]
7787
fn get_array_size(&self) -> i32 {
7888
self.array_size

0 commit comments

Comments
 (0)